Itinerary Overview

Taking you on a thrilling journey through the captivating landscapes and cultural wonders of the Mohare Hill Trek, this itinerary offers an unforgettable adventure in the heart of Nepal. The trek duration is 6 days, providing ample time to learn about the beauty of the region. The trek difficulty is moderate, making it accessible to a wide range of trekkers.
Here is an overview of the itinerary:
| Day | Destination | Elevation (m) | Trekking Time |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Kathmandu to Pokhara | 820 | – |
| 2 | Pokhara to Galeshwor | 1,070 | 5-6 hours |
| 3 | Galeshwor to Bans Kharka | 1,520 | 5-6 hours |
| 4 | Bans Kharka to Mohare | 3,300 | 6-7 hours |
| 5 | Mohare to Deurali | 2,100 | 6-7 hours |
| 6 | Deurali to Nayapul | 1,070 | 4-5 hours |
| Nayapul to Pokhara | 820 | – |

Inclusions and Exclusions

The Mohare Hill Private Guided Trek includes various inclusions and exclusions to ensure a seamless and unforgettable adventure in the heart of Nepal.
When it comes to pricing and payment options, the trek offers a price starting from €933.81.
As for the inclusions, the trek covers accommodation as mentioned in the itinerary, all required transportation arrangements, meals as mentioned, necessary paperwork such as National Park Entry Permits and TIMS Card, an English-speaking licensed trek guide, a porter during the trek, and all government and local taxes.
However, there are some exclusions to consider. Personal expenses, Kathmandu sightseeing entrance fee, and lunch and dinner in Kathmandu are not included in the trek package.
It’s important to note that the National Park Entry Permits and TIMS Card are crucial for the trek as they allow access to the protected areas and ensure safety.

Additional Information
Occasionally, travelers may have additional questions or concerns regarding the Mohare Hill Private Guided Trek. Here are some important points to consider:
Trek Difficulty: The Mohare Hill Trek is considered a moderate trek, suitable for individuals with a good level of fitness and some prior trekking experience. It involves walking for an average of 5-6 hours per day, with some uphill and downhill sections. However, with the support of an experienced trek guide and porter, it’s manageable for most people.
Best Time to Go: The best time to embark on the Mohare Hill Trek is during the sp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) seasons. These months offer clear skies, moderate temperatures, and stunning views of the surrounding mountains. It’s important to note that the weather conditions can vary, so it’s advisable to check the forecast and pack accordingly.
Safety Measures: Safety is a top priority during the trek. The trek guide will provide essential information about altitude sickness, acclimatization, and emergency procedures. It’s recommended to follow their instructions, stay hydrated, and take regular breaks to adjust to the altitude.
Equipment and Gear: It’s essential to pack appropriate trekking gear, including sturdy hiking boots, warm clothing, a waterproof jacket, a hat, sunglasses, a backpack, and a sleeping bag. It’s also advisable to carry a first aid kit, sunscreen, insect repellent, and a water bottle.
